Jindilli names Steffenhagen director of training & product development
POSTED 30 Sep 2015 . BY Jane Kitchen
Lynille Steffenhagen Credit: Jindilli
Lynille Steffenhagen Credit: Jindilli
Skincare company Jindilli has named Lynille Steffenhagen as director of training and product development. With a global career in the health and wellness industry spanning nearly 20 years, Steffenhagen is charged with elevating Jindilli’s spa education and training program for luxury spas worldwide.

“Lynille adds a lot of depth and insight to our growing company, especially in the delivery of training and support – we are very excited to have her,” said Cherie Jackson, chief brand officer for Jindilli. “Her experience as a resort spa director, combined with her expertise in advanced clinical aesthetics, are an ideal combination to grow Jindilli’s treatment and retail presence in the luxury spa market.”

Steffenhagen began her aesthetics career in her home town of Johannnesburg, South Africa, working for hotel groups and spas across Africa, and she has also worked for Steiner Leisure aboard the Royal Caribbean “Voyager of the Seas” cruise ship and for Hyatt Hotels.

“Working for Jindilli in the US and across the globe in an ideal next step for me,” said Steffenhagen. “The line is ideally poised for growth in the resort and day spa markets.”

Based in Chicago, Jindilli’s products and treatments feature cold-pressed, sustainably farmed macadamia nut oil sourced from Australian farms. The Rite of Renewal spa menu features the BoomaGlam scraping tool for massage and body, based on indigenous purification ceremonies.
